
Ian Black
Ian Black has been Vicar of Whitkirk in Leeds, in the Diocese of Ripon and Leeds, since 2002. He is also a member of the Chapter of Ripon Cathedral. He previously served in Maidstone, Kent, and as priest-in-charge of a group of parishes 10 miles north-west of Canterbury. He was a Minor Canon of Canterbury Cathedral, a prison chaplain and assistant Director of Post-Ordination Training for the Diocese of Canterbury.
Prior to ordination Ian had a career in tax, both with the Inland Revenue as a PAYE auditor and in a firm of chartered accountants as a tax accountant. Ian is married with two sons. He is the author of three books on prayer: Prayers for All Occasions (SPCK, 2011), Intercessions for Years A, B & C (SPCK, 2009), and Intercessions for the Calendar of Saints and Holy Days (SPCK, 2005).
